Children have been victims of the recent escalation of conflict in Gaza and southern Israel.

The Office of the Special Representative of the Secretary-General for Children and Armed Conflict says that since Wednesday, 60 Palestinian children were reportedly injured and at least four reportedly killed during Israeli airstrikes including an 11 month old boy, as well as a pregnant woman.

The United Nations has also received information of more than 50 Israeli civilians injured by rockets fired from Gaza into Israel. Reports indicate that children were among the casualties.

Special Representative of the Secretary-General for Children and Armed Conflict, Ms. Leila Zerrougui has called "on all parties to immediately stop the violence and to fully respect their obligations under international humanitarian law to protect girls and boys from the fighting".

The outbreak of hostilities also threatens children's access to education. All educational facilities in Gaza and schools in southern Israel within a 40 km radius of the border with Gaza were closed due to the increasing number of attacks.

Special Representative Zerrougui stressed that "especially in times of conflict, the security of schools, students and teachers and access to education for all children must be guaranteed."
